Thanks Bro for the practical calculations. Personally I rather not go with how many prints it can go as it depends highly on many factors.
1. Total area of coverage
2. Paper Size
3. Paper Type
4. Colour preference
5. Combo of Text, Graphics & Photo Prints
6. Maintenance
7. External Factors
For example taken from EPSON Official Source for C67 Model
http://www.epson.com.my/products/downloads/C67_Spec.pdfQUOTE
Standard Capacity Black Ink (T0631) Approx. 250 pages*4
Cyan Ink Cartridge (T0632)
Magenta Ink Cartridge (T0633) Approx. 380 pages*5 (Composite Yield)
Yellow Ink Cartridge (T0634)
I can only say the set is provided with 100ml per colour. Printing Mileage will vary from user to user as their printing preferences differ.
With all factors remaining constant, it's the price per ml of ink that shows the savings compared with Original/OEM carts! (still ignoring the savings on ink as the system does not clean the printhead anymore)
